Solving Problems and Making Decisions. (M3.01)

This week heavy snow has been forecast across the UK which will prove to be a big problem on the particular construction job that we are now on.

The contractor has receievd a detailed weather report specific to our particular region and heavy snowfalls are iminent which will have an adverse effect on this large open site.

Steps will have to be implemented to make sure that the weather causes as little disruption as possible.

Like all tasks carried out, it is important to follow the method statements and adhere to the risks assessments .

A meeting is called with the project manager, the client and the various different supervisors and foremen on the job.

In the meeting it is agreed that as long as it is deemed safe for normal operations to be carried out without any risk to the workers, then its business as usual, however if conditions change for the worse then the relevant supervisor must alert the office and cease operations and escort the men to the welfare facilities.
There the weather will be closely monitored. If the conditions get worse then the site shall be closed and the personnel sent home, however if subsides and it is safe to continue operations, then the workers would be asked to return to what they had been doing.

So on the morning of the expected snowfall, it is relayed to the men in the daily briefing that the weather could prove to be a problem to the days operations.
They are working approximately 500 metres away from the main welfare facilities laying steel reinforcement for a ground slab. A weather review will be carried out at 10 am and again at midday in the main canteen.

As it is extremely cold, all have appropriate clothing on and a thermometer is placed beside the area of work.
